    First Contract Overwhelmingly Ratified at ABM
    09/25/23 - Teamsters Local 89
    On September 23rd, Shuttle Bus Drivers at ABM overwhelmingly ratified their first Teamsters contract with just one “no” vote cast. At approximately 180 employees, this is the largest newly organized shop to be added to Local 89 in decades and is one of the largest organizing victories of any union in modern Kentucky history.

    ‘Going to Kill Somebody’: Concerns Over Bill to Allow 90,000 lb. Trucks Nationwide
    09/20/23 - Teamsters Local 992
    Sept. 20, 2023 | TRANSPORTATION | Douglas County Sheriff Aaron Hanson and Nebraska Teamsters visited Washington D.C. last week to persuade lawmakers to vote 'no' on a trucking industry bill. It would allow semis to carry more weight, up to 91,000 pounds. Right now, the max is 80,000 pounds.

    Labor’s Militant Creativity
    09/19/23 - Teamsters Local 570
    Sept. 19, 2023 | SELECTIVE STRIKES | Many observers have been impressed with UAW President Shawn Fain’s astute strategy of using selective strikes rather than calling all of his members off the job. The strategy has three significant tactical benefits. First, it conserves the strike fund, which would only last about 90 days if all workers were out.

    Update: Upcoming Murder Trial Info for Ret Sgt Ralph Harper
    09/16/23 - Saint Louis Police Officers Association
    Update from case Detective: Regarding the murder trial for retired SLMPD Sergeant Ralph Harper. At 1:00pm this afternoon (9/18/23), the defendant pled guilty to Murder 2nd Degree, Robbery 1st Degree and two counts of Armed Criminal Action. As part of a plea agreement with the State, he was sentenced to 20 years on the Murder 2nd Degree charge, 15 years on the Robbery 1st Degree charge and 6 years on the two Armed Criminal Action charges with the terms to be run concurrently. The Harper family was present in the courtroom and heard the defendant admit his responsibility in the fatal shooting. They are thankful for the support from the SLMPD and are relieved to finally have a conclusion to this tragic incident.

    Amazon Forces Employees to Sign Confidentiality Agreements That Prevent Union Organizing
    09/14/23 - Teamsters Local 570
    Sept. 14, 2023 | WORKERS' RIGHTS | The National Labor Relations Board filed a complaint against Amazon on Monday for having its employees sign a confidentiality agreement that the Board says restricts their rights to unionization. The complaint names Andy Jassy, Amazon’s CEO, as well as two Amazon Prime Air supervisors, as people who required employees to sign the agreement.

    Second year of Boch Center Theater CBAs in effect 9/1/23
    09/13/23 - IATSE Local B4
    The second year of the Boch Center Wang and Shubert theater contracts have gone into effect. You will notice ann increase in your hourly wage. The The base usher rate went from $15.75 to $16.22 per hour. Also to note, the boys structure we've had for the past two contracts of six years was negotiated and replaced with 4% vacation pay that is paid out at the end of each contract year.
